Five Ways You Can Prepare Your Home for the Autumn Season

  1. Clean out your home’s gutters. During the summer months, your home’s gutters can collect all sorts of debris, including insects, leaves, twigs, and dirt. This can cause your gutters to clog, and allow rainwater to build up – which can lead to property damage like mold growth and roof damage. While generally, you can clean your gutters yourself, if you’re not sure how to do so or if you’re concerned about doing it properly, you can call a professional for help.
  2. Prepare your outdoor AC component. This is simple to do yourself. Over the summer, weeds and other vegetation may have grown up around the outdoor component of your air conditioning system. Dirt and debris may have collected there, and occasionally pests may make their nests around the system. Remove visible vegetation growth and debris, and gently hose off your system. It’s also a good idea to cover your system with an air conditioner cover once it’s no longer in use. Make sure to cover only the AC unit and not the heat pump.
  3. Get your garden ready for cooler weather. If you have flower beds around your home, remove any annual flowering plants that are dying off and weeds that have cropped up. You might choose to wrap some plants in burlap for the upcoming cooler season, to protect them from the elements. Plant any spring bulbs such as daffodils, tulips, and crocuses. Replenish mulch, and add fertilizer such as manure or compost to help prepare the soil for its wintertime nap.
  4. Make sure doors and windows are weatherproofed. Weatherproofing your doors and windows is a simple way to help your home stay warmer and be more energy-efficient once the outdoor temperatures start to dip down. Weatherstripping can help keep cold air out and warm air in and is readily available at your local home and hardware store. While weatherstripping your doors and windows, check for any concerns (such as cracked windows or rotting window or door frames) and consider having these repairs or replacements completed before winter.
